Not sure if this is a problem or not but temp and humidity have been running great but today after removing the turner the temp went to 100.8 and has not went down. Have used this incubator
a couple of times and never had this issue. Is this a problem or am I worrying needlessly?

You might need to adjust it. There are some lttle(tiny levers) under the lid. Follow the directions to change the settings. I had to adjust mine recently after not being used for a year, could be me.
 
not to worry.. you had it open, it is searching for the correct temp..

just watch it.. perhaps if you add some water and raise the hum the temp might drop some..
 
I agree...up the humidity and the temp should come down a bit. Give it time to adjust. It could also be due to moving your thermometer to another position that is making it more sensitive and reading higher.
 
The temp and the humidity will rise until the chicks hatch. It is thier body temp knicking in. If the humidity has been around 55%, it might go as high as 70% with nothing to worry about. I would not make any adjustment at all. You are well within safe range.
 
day 19 , the eggs will start to make heat , if you have a bator full you'll notice, I had 20 chicks hopping around tuesday and the temp went up to 101 because of the body heat.
